From 852500e66b8027bd94e51d05c16b92b699a86e4b Mon Sep 17 00:00:00 2001 From: "Gervaise H. Henry" <gervaise.henry@utsouthwestern.edu> Date: Tue, 9 Apr 2019 21:43:50 -0500 Subject: [PATCH] Add process tags --- workflow/main.nf | 15 +++++++-------- 1 file changed, 7 insertions(+), 8 deletions(-) diff --git a/workflow/main.nf b/workflow/main.nf index cb628ae..2464f18 100755 --- a/workflow/main.nf +++ b/workflow/main.nf @@ -20,8 +20,8 @@ outDir = params.outDir references = params.references process checkDesignFile { - - publishDir "$outDir/${task.process}", mode: 'copy' + tag "${bcl.baseName}" + publishDir "$outDir/misc/${task.process}/${bcl.baseName}", mode: 'copy' input: @@ -44,7 +44,6 @@ process checkDesignFile { process untarBCL { tag "$tar" - publishDir "$outDir/${task.process}", mode: 'copy' input: @@ -72,7 +71,6 @@ process untarBCL { process mkfastq { tag "${bcl.baseName}" queue '128GB,256GB,256GBv1,384GB' - publishDir "$outDir/${task.process}", mode: 'copy' input: @@ -101,9 +99,9 @@ process mkfastq { process fastqc { + tag "${bcl.baseName}" queue 'super' - - publishDir "$outDir/${task.process}", mode: 'copy' + publishDir "$outDir/misc/${task.process}/${bcl.baseName}", mode: 'copy' input: file fastqPaths @@ -126,7 +124,8 @@ process fastqc { process versions { - publishDir "$outDir/${task.process}", mode: 'copy' + tag "${bcl.baseName}" + publishDir "$outDir/misc/${task.process}/${bcl.baseName}", mode: 'copy' input: @@ -150,8 +149,8 @@ process versions { process multiqc { + tag "${bcl.baseName}" queue 'super' - publishDir "$outDir/${task.process}", mode: 'copy' input: -- GitLab